Last weekend really was a treat as we worked our way thru 4 1/4 finals. We live in Christchurch so have been denied any local games due to our quakes but were on the edge of our seats at home as we watched the finalists fight to stay in the competition. Some of the contenders desparately wanted a win. We saw the best from the French sending the English home. The Welsh beating the Irish. The Australians finally beat the South Africans after a grim battle. New Zealand given a fright by Argentina before breaking thru their strong defenses and scoring trys. 4 really great games of rugby.
We trust NZ can beat Australia this weekend and perhaps go on to play against France in the Final......shouldnt count ones chickens before they hatch eh! New Zealand is gripped by Rugby fever with All Black flags everywhere. A truly fired up experience.
